widener University is Hiring a Media Production Manager Near Chester, PA

Widener University is currently seeking a Media Production Manager in the Communication Studies Department of the College of Arts and Sciences. This position reports to the Chair and is an integral member of the Communication department. The Media Production Manager provides technological support to the state-of-the-art television studio, podcast studio, equipment room, graphics lab, and editing suites. This staff member will partner with faculty to provide an industry-standard production studio experience. The Media Production Manager mentors student-production groups, including WU Productions and Widener Film Society. This staff member will also assist the department manage the digital screens inside Freedom Hall and contribute content to departmental social media channels.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ES (including, but not limited to):

Essential duties:

  • Oversee the technical and production functions of the television studio, control room, podcast studio, editing suites, equipment room, and graphics lab.
  • Update the digital screens within Freedom Hall to reflect upcoming events or relevant content, such as an Alumni/Student feature series.
  • Collaborate with University Relations and Campus Athletes on special projects, including podcasts and video production. This also includes assisting with live-streaming events.
  • Advise student-run groups, including WU Productions (student-led-broadcast organization), Widener Film Society (independent films), and other out-of-the-classroom production-related functions.
  • Participate in departmental events such as Widener Day Admitted Students Day, TEDx Widener, and Commencement.

Secondary responsibilities:

  • Contribute content to departmental social media channels.
  • Manage outreach events such as collaboration with the Philadelphia Union and a Summer Mini-Camp.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S (education/training and experience required):

Required:

  • BA or BS in Communication Studies or a complementary discipline
  • One to three years of experience working in a television studio environment
  • Working knowledge of Adobe Creative Suite and Microsoft Office, and ability to maintain video equipment, apply firmware updates; perform minor repairs and update firmware
  • Ability to operate digital DSLR cameras and lighting equipment applications;
  • Working knowledge of audio/video patch bay configurations
  • Demonstrated proficiency digital video editing, Final Cut Pro, Premiere, TV/Film production studios, and broadcast equipment
  • Ability to maintain a positive demeanor at all times in a fast-paced environment with frequent interruptions
  • Demonstrated interpersonal skills and the ability to work collaboratively with faculty and staff. Leadership skills are essential to mentor student organizations and work independently.
  • Ability to manage media equipment utilization and circulation process;
  • Consult faculty to define equipment and services needs and priorities, and move equipment between facilities to maximize customer satisfaction; set up and operate equipment as requested.

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S AND/OR UNUSUAL HOURS:

  • Subject to standing, walking, sitting, bending, reaching, kneeling, pushing and pulling, lifting fifty pounds, repetitive motions.
  • Willing to work occasional evening and weekend hours as needed
